-
1
-
-
0034448992
-
Adaptive optimization in the Jalape-no JVM
-
Arnold, M., Fink, S., Grove, D., Hind, M., Sweeney, P.F.: Adaptive optimization in the Jalape-no JVM. ACM SIGPLAN Notices 35(10), 47-65 (2000)
-
(2000)
ACM SIGPLAN Notices
, vol.35
, Issue.10
, pp. 47-65
-
-
Arnold, M.1
Fink, S.2
Grove, D.3
Hind, M.4
Sweeney, P.F.5
-
2
-
-
0037810283
-
Online feedback-directed optimization of java
-
Arnold, M., Hind, M., Ryder, B.G.: Online feedback-directed optimization of java. SIGPLAN Not. 37(11), 111-129 (2002)
-
(2002)
SIGPLAN Not
, vol.37
, Issue.11
, pp. 111-129
-
-
Arnold, M.1
Hind, M.2
Ryder, B.G.3
-
3
-
-
70350661908
-
-
Browne, S., Dongarra, J., Garner, N., London, K., Mucci, P.: A scalable crossplatform infrastructure for application performance tuning using hardware counters. In: SC, Dallas, Texas (November 2000)
-
Browne, S., Dongarra, J., Garner, N., London, K., Mucci, P.: A scalable crossplatform infrastructure for application performance tuning using hardware counters. In: SC, Dallas, Texas (November 2000)
-
-
-
-
4
-
-
85013569584
-
-
Calder, B., Grunwald, D.: Reducing branch costs via branch alignment. In: ASPLOS (October 1994)
-
Calder, B., Grunwald, D.: Reducing branch costs via branch alignment. In: ASPLOS (October 1994)
-
-
-
-
5
-
-
4544268078
-
-
Cavazos, J., Moss, J.E.B.: Inducing heuristics to decide whether to schedule. In: PLDI, pp. 183-194. ACM Press, New York (2004)
-
Cavazos, J., Moss, J.E.B.: Inducing heuristics to decide whether to schedule. In: PLDI, pp. 183-194. ACM Press, New York (2004)
-
-
-
-
6
-
-
70350675865
-
-
Cavazos, J., O'Boyle, M.F.P.: Automatic tuning of inlining heuristics. In: SC, Washington, DC, USA, p. 14. IEEE Computer Society, Los Alamitos (2005)
-
Cavazos, J., O'Boyle, M.F.P.: Automatic tuning of inlining heuristics. In: SC, Washington, DC, USA, p. 14. IEEE Computer Society, Los Alamitos (2005)
-
-
-
-
7
-
-
0036679993
-
Adaptive optimizing compilers for the 21st century
-
Cooper, K.D., Subramanian, D., Torczon, L.: Adaptive optimizing compilers for the 21st century. J. Supercomput. 23(1), 7-22 (2002)
-
(2002)
J. Supercomput
, vol.23
, Issue.1
, pp. 7-22
-
-
Cooper, K.D.1
Subramanian, D.2
Torczon, L.3
-
8
-
-
0031334454
-
-
Gloy, N., Blackwell, T., Smith, M.D., Calder, B.: Procedure placement using temporal ordering information. In: MICRO, pp. 303-313 (1997)
-
Gloy, N., Blackwell, T., Smith, M.D., Calder, B.: Procedure placement using temporal ordering information. In: MICRO, pp. 303-313 (1997)
-
-
-
-
9
-
-
0030713512
-
Efficient procedure mapping using cache line coloring
-
Hashemi, A.H., Kaeli, D.R., Calder, B.: Efficient procedure mapping using cache line coloring. In: PLDI, pp. 171-182 (1997)
-
(1997)
PLDI
, pp. 171-182
-
-
Hashemi, A.H.1
Kaeli, D.R.2
Calder, B.3
-
10
-
-
12844288604
-
-
Hauswirth, M.,Sweeney,P.F., Diwan, A., Hind, M.: Vertical profiling: Understanding the behavior of object-oriented applications. In: OOPSLA (2004)
-
Hauswirth, M.,Sweeney,P.F., Diwan, A., Hind, M.: Vertical profiling: Understanding the behavior of object-oriented applications. In: OOPSLA (2004)
-
-
-
-
11
-
-
33745263228
-
-
Jiménez, D.A.: Code placement for improving dynamic branch prediction accuracy. In: PLDI, pp. 107-116. ACM Press, New York (2005)
-
Jiménez, D.A.: Code placement for improving dynamic branch prediction accuracy. In: PLDI, pp. 107-116. ACM Press, New York (2005)
-
-
-
-
12
-
-
33746072602
-
Online performance auditing: Using hot optimizations without getting burned
-
Lau, J., Arnold, M., Hind, M., Calder, B.: Online performance auditing: using hot optimizations without getting burned. SIGPLAN Not. 41(6), 239-251 (2006)
-
(2006)
SIGPLAN Not
, vol.41
, Issue.6
, pp. 239-251
-
-
Lau, J.1
Arnold, M.2
Hind, M.3
Calder, B.4
-
13
-
-
33745620214
-
Understanding the behavior of compiler optimizations
-
Lee, H., von Dincklage, D., Diwan, A., Eliot, J., Moss, B.: Understanding the behavior of compiler optimizations. Softw. Pract. Exper. 36(8), 835-844 (2006)
-
(2006)
Softw. Pract. Exper
, vol.36
, Issue.8
, pp. 835-844
-
-
Lee, H.1
von Dincklage, D.2
Diwan, A.3
Eliot, J.4
Moss, B.5
-
14
-
-
0023592629
-
Superoptimizer: A look at the smallest program
-
Massalin, H.: Superoptimizer: a look at the smallest program. SIGPLAN Not. 22(10), 122-126 (1987)
-
(1987)
SIGPLAN Not
, vol.22
, Issue.10
, pp. 122-126
-
-
Massalin, H.1
-
15
-
-
0024859772
-
-
Mcfarling, S.: Program optimization for instruction caches. In: ASPLOS, pp. 183-191. ACM, New York (1989)
-
Mcfarling, S.: Program optimization for instruction caches. In: ASPLOS, pp. 183-191. ACM, New York (1989)
-
-
-
-
16
-
-
84976682502
-
Procedure merging with instruction caches
-
Mcfarling, S.: Procedure merging with instruction caches. In: PLDI, pp. 71-79 (1991)
-
(1991)
PLDI
, pp. 71-79
-
-
Mcfarling, S.1
-
17
-
-
0036832961
-
Building a basic block instruction scheduler with reinforcement learning and rollouts
-
McGovern, A., Moss, E., Barto, A.G.: Building a basic block instruction scheduler with reinforcement learning and rollouts. Mach. Learn. 49(2-3), 141-160 (2002)
-
(2002)
Mach. Learn
, vol.49
, Issue.2-3
, pp. 141-160
-
-
McGovern, A.1
Moss, E.2
Barto, A.G.3
-
18
-
-
67650046387
-
-
Mytkowicz, T., Diwan, A., Hauswirth, M., Sweeney, P.F.: Producing wrong data without doing anything obviously wrong? In: ASPLOS (2009)
-
Mytkowicz, T., Diwan, A., Hauswirth, M., Sweeney, P.F.: Producing wrong data without doing anything obviously wrong? In: ASPLOS (2009)
-
-
-
-
19
-
-
70350628572
-
-
Pan, Z., Eigenmann, R.: Fast and effective orchestration of compiler optimizations for automatic performance tuning. In: CGO, Washington, DC, USA, pp. 319-332. IEEE Computer Society, Los Alamitos (2006)
-
Pan, Z., Eigenmann, R.: Fast and effective orchestration of compiler optimizations for automatic performance tuning. In: CGO, Washington, DC, USA, pp. 319-332. IEEE Computer Society, Los Alamitos (2006)
-
-
-
-
20
-
-
0025447909
-
Profile guided code positioning
-
June
-
Pettis, K., Hansen, R.C.: Profile guided code positioning. In: PLDI, pp. 16-27 (June 1990)
-
(1990)
PLDI
, pp. 16-27
-
-
Pettis, K.1
Hansen, R.C.2
-
21
-
-
42149103197
-
-
ISMM, pp, ACM Press, New York 2007
-
Singer, J., Brown, G., Watson, I., Cavazos, J.: Intelligent selection of applicationspecific garbage collectors. In: ISMM, pp. 91-102. ACM Press, New York (2007)
-
Intelligent selection of applicationspecific garbage collectors
, pp. 91-102
-
-
Singer, J.1
Brown, G.2
Watson, I.3
Cavazos, J.4
-
22
-
-
63549125605
-
-
Standard Performance Evaluation Corporation
-
Standard Performance Evaluation Corporation. SPEC CPU2006 Benchmarks, http://www.spec.org/cpu2006/
-
SPEC CPU2006 Benchmarks
-
-
-
23
-
-
0001324927
-
Code placement techniques for cache miss rate reduction
-
Tomiyama, H., Yasuura, H.: Code placement techniques for cache miss rate reduction. ACM Trans. Des. Autom. Electron. Syst. 2(4), 410-429 (1997)
-
(1997)
ACM Trans. Des. Autom. Electron. Syst
, vol.2
, Issue.4
, pp. 410-429
-
-
Tomiyama, H.1
Yasuura, H.2
-
24
-
-
67650534864
-
-
Triantafyllis, S., Vachharajani, M., Vachharajani, N., August, D.I.: Compiler optimization-space exploration. In: CGO, Washington, DC, USA, pp. 204-215. IEEE Computer Society Press, Los Alamitos (2003)
-
Triantafyllis, S., Vachharajani, M., Vachharajani, N., August, D.I.: Compiler optimization-space exploration. In: CGO, Washington, DC, USA, pp. 204-215. IEEE Computer Society Press, Los Alamitos (2003)
-
-
-
|